public interface

UserEntitiesSelectorBean

implements UserEntitiesBrowserBean
com.microstrategy.web.app.beans.UserEntitiesSelectorBean

Class Overview

The interface UserEntitiesSelectorBean encapslute three types of sources to fetch users and groups: (1) all top level user groups, (2) parents or members of a particular user group, and (3) search result of users or groups.

Summary

Constants
int SELECT_MEMBERS Indicates to select the members of a particular user group.
int SELECT_PARENTS Indicates to select the parent groups of a particular user group.
[Expand]
Inherited Constants
From interface com.microstrategy.utils.serialization.EnumWebPersistableState
From interface com.microstrategy.web.app.beans.AppComponent
From interface com.microstrategy.web.objects.Scrollable
Public Methods
abstract UserEntitiesBean getSelectedItems()
Returns the selected users or groups from the target bean.
abstract int getSelectionType()
Returns the selection type, either parents or members.
abstract void setSelectionType(int type)
Sets the selection type, either parents or members.
[Expand]
Inherited Methods
From interface com.microstrategy.utils.serialization.Persistable
From interface com.microstrategy.web.app.beans.AppComponent
From interface com.microstrategy.web.app.beans.UserEntitiesBrowserBean
From interface com.microstrategy.web.beans.RequestPersistable
From interface com.microstrategy.web.beans.Transformable
From interface com.microstrategy.web.beans.WebComponent
From interface com.microstrategy.web.objects.Scrollable

Constants

public static final int SELECT_MEMBERS

Indicates to select the members of a particular user group.

Constant Value: 1 (0x00000001)

public static final int SELECT_PARENTS

Indicates to select the parent groups of a particular user group.

Constant Value: 0 (0x00000000)

Public Methods

public abstract UserEntitiesBean getSelectedItems ()

Returns the selected users or groups from the target bean.

Returns
  • the selected users or groups.
See Also

public abstract int getSelectionType ()

Returns the selection type, either parents or members.

Returns
  • the selection type.

public abstract void setSelectionType (int type)

Sets the selection type, either parents or members.

Parameters
type the selection type.